Should you buy solar batteries for off-grid PV systems?

When you buy solar batteries to make up the entire battery bank, you have a few options. The most common battery type for off-grid PV systems is a 12V nominal solar battery. You then take these batteries and wire them in a series-parallel arrangement to achieve the voltage and capacity characteristics you’re after.

How much battery does a solar generator need?

Depending on your power consumption, you’ll typically need anywhere from 5-15kWh of batteries to live sufficiently off the grid with solar. The recharging rate of your solar generator can also affect its ability to be used consistently off the grid.

What voltage do I need for a battery based inverter?

For any battery-based system you install, you need to look at battery bank nominal voltage s of 12, 24, or 48VDC. These voltages correspond to the inverter input requirements for the majority of commercially available inverters.
